What is Study Abroad Insurance Form

The Study Abroad Health and Repatriation Insurance Form is a medical consent document used by students to certify adequate international health and repatriation insurance coverage for study abroad programs.

Purpose and Benefits of the Study Abroad Health and Repatriation Insurance Form

This form serves to protect students by confirming they hold insurance that covers medical needs while abroad. Having repatriation insurance is particularly beneficial, as it covers costs related to returning home in case of emergencies. Thus, it's a vital safeguard when engaging in study abroad experiences.
  • Provides necessary medical coverage in emergencies.
  • Facilitates access to healthcare without significant expenses.
  • Ensures peace of mind while studying in a foreign country.

Who Needs the Study Abroad Health and Repatriation Insurance Form?

The requirement to complete this form applies primarily to students engaging in specific study abroad programs. Those traveling to countries with differing healthcare systems or attending institutions that mandate insurance coverage must submit it.
  • Students in exchange programs or international internships.
  • Participants in programs that do not provide insurance coverage.
  • Those undertaking long-term study abroad experiences.
